,Chinese Patent Application Serial No. 202122409109.9, filed on September 30, 2021 - The present application relates to the field of air conditioner manufacturing, and more particularly to a water pan and an air conditioner.
- Air conditioner products are developing in the direction of compact structure and efficient performance. A size of an air outlet of the air conditioners affects the overall air volume and heat exchange efficiency of the air conditioners. In related art, a plurality of small air outlets is usually provided, and the circulation area of each air outlet is small, so the overall air volume is difficult to be improved.
- The air outlet problem of the air conditioners has become a barrier to be solved urgently under the trend of efficient-performance development. Moreover, in related art, it is the difficult to increase the air outlet area of a water pan due to the limitations of its structure and the production process.
- The present application is intended to solve at least one of the problems existing in the related art to at least some extent. Therefore, embodiments of the present application provide a water pan, including:
- a plastic member, an air inlet being defined in a middle of the plastic member, an air outlet being defined near an edge of the plastic member, a water receiving sink being defined between the air inlet and the air outlet, the water receiving sink surrounding the air inlet, the air outlet continuously surrounding at least part of an outer edge of the water receiving sink, a plurality of supporting grilles being arranged in the air outlet, the plurality of supporting grilles being distributed at intervals along an extension direction of the air outlet; and
- a foaming member, the foaming member and the plastic member at least partially overlapping with each other, and the foaming member avoiding the air inlet and the air outlet.
- The water pan of embodiments of the present application has the following technical effect: the air outlet is arranged into a continuously extended structure, a circulation area of the air outlet is increased, thus improving air outlet efficiency, and facilitating the improvement of the performance of the air conditioner.

- Embodiments of the present application provide a water pan, the water pan is used for an air conditioner, which may improve the efficiency of air inlet and air outlet, has high overall structural stability, and may improve the convenience and accuracy of installation on an air conditioner. The air conditioner may be a central air conditioner, and the water pan may be installed on an indoor air inlet and outlet device of the central air conditioner.
- Referring to
FIG. 1 to FIG. 6 , the water pan of embodiments of the present application mainly includes two parts of aplastic member 10 and a foamingmember 20, and the two parts are connected as a whole and do not need to be connected by a screw and other connectors. Although the materials of theplastic member 10 and the foamingmember 20 are different, they have an integrally formed structure, and there is no need to assemble separately when in use, thus improving the convenience of installation, improving production efficiency, and further facilitating improvement of the accuracy of the relative position between theair inlet 11 and a related component of the air conditioner. - Referring to
FIG. 1 andFIG. 3 , anair inlet 11 is defined in a middle of theplastic member 10, anair outlet 12 is defined near an edge of theplastic member 10, and awater receiving sink 17 is defined between theair inlet 11 and theair outlet 12. Thewater receiving sink 17 surrounds theair inlet 11, and theair outlet 12 continuously surrounds at least part of an outer edge of thewater receiving sink 17. A plurality of supportinggrilles 14 is arranged in theair outlet 12, and the plurality of supportinggrilles 14 is distributed at intervals along an extension direction of theair outlet 12. In embodiments of the present application, only oneair outlet 12 is provided, and continuously surrounds thewater receiving sink 17, to form an annular air outlet, thus increasing the circulation area of theair outlet 12. Although the supportinggrille 14 is arranged in theair outlet 12, the circulation area of theair outlet 12 occupied by the supportinggrille 14 is very small, and the total circulation area of theair outlet 12 is far greater than the total circulation area of a plurality of air outlets provided in the related art. Thewater receiving sink 17 is arranged as a long strip shape and extends along a predetermined direction to contain the condensate water and transfer the collected condensate water to a preset pipe. In some embodiments, thewater receiving sink 17 is a continuous recess, and the condensate water may flow within thewater receiving sink 17. The supportinggrille 14 is a plate-like body, and a thickness of the supportinggrille 14 gradually decreases along an air outlet direction. That is, a width of a cross-section of the supportinggrille 14 at different locations may be different. The setting may not only reduce wind resistance, but also has the effect of reducing noise. - In the related art, the water pan is made of foam, and the strength of foam is low, so at the air outlet, a long connection structure needs to be provided to connect a frame, which will cause a larger area of blocking to the air outlet.
- In some embodiments, the foaming
member 20 is integrally formed with theplastic member 10. - In the present application, the water pan is made by foaming a foam material on the plastic member, the strength of the plastic member is high, the strength of the water pan formed by the process is high, and the section of the supporting
grille 14 for connecting afirst frame 16 at the air outlet may be made very small. As shown inFIG. 3 , the proportion of the wind shield area of the supportinggrille 14 in the air outlet to the total area of the air outlet is very small, which may even be ignored, so that the annular air outlet may be achieved. - For example, the
air outlet 12 is a bent long-strip hole with a certain length, and the width of theair outlet 12 may be set according to the actual design requirements. - The supporting
grille 14 plays the role of supporting and connection, which may be made as thin as possible under the premise of meeting the structural strength requirements, to reduce wind resistance. - Referring to
FIG. 2 , the foamingmember 20 and theplastic member 10 at least partially overlap with each other, which play a role of heat preservation, so that the water pan achieves the effect of anti-condensation. The foamingmember 20 avoids theair inlet 11 and theair outlet 12. The foamingmember 20 is connected with theplastic member 10 and is relatively fixed. In some embodiments, the foamingmember 20 is integrally formed with theplastic member 10, the foamingmember 20 defines thewater receiving sink 17, thewater receiving sink 17 surrounds theair inlet 11, and theair outlet 12 surrounds thewater receiving sink 17. Since the foamingmember 20 and theplastic members 10 are integrally formed, the foamingmember 20 and theplastic members 10 also do not need to be assembled separately. Although the materials of the foamingmember 20 and theplastic members 10 are different, they may be formed by injection molding. Therefore, the foamingmember 20 and theplastic members 10 may be casted respectively by controlling the casting sequence of different materials, and the foamingmember 20 and theplastic member 10 are connected as a whole. - In some embodiments, in order to avoid the
air inlet 11 and theair outlet 12, an airinlet avoidance hole 23 is defined in a middle of the foamingmember 20, and an airoutlet avoidance hole 24 is defined between asecond frame 25 and thewater receiving sink 17. The airinlet avoidance hole 23 corresponds in position to theair inlet 11, and the airoutlet avoidance hole 24 corresponds in position to theair outlet 12. The airinlet avoidance hole 23 is a circular shape matching theair inlet 11, and the airoutlet avoidance hole 24 is a bent long strip-shaped hole matching the shape of theair outlet 12. - In some embodiments, the supporting
grille 14 is arranged along a direction from theair inlet 11 to theair outlet 12, and a width of the supportinggrille 14 ranges from 1.5 mm to 3.2 mm. Since theplastic member 10 is made entirely of plastic material, the width of the supportinggrille 14 that is available for mold-opening may be controlled above 1.5 mm. According to the test and the needs of the structural strength of the water pan, in embodiments of the present application, the width of the supportinggrille 14 is limited to 3.2 mm. Thus, the width of the supportinggrille 14 may be 1.6 mm, 1.8 mm, 2.0 mm, 2.2 mm, 2.4 mm, 2.6 mm, 2.8 mm, 3.0 mm, etc. The supportinggrille 14 of the size not only has sufficient structural strength, but also causes very small wind resistance to theair outlet 12, which realizes a larger air outlet area and improves air outlet efficiency. - The width of the supporting
grille 14 mentioned here refers to the thickness of the cross-section of the supportinggrille 14 occupying theair outlet 12, that is, a distance between the two sides of the supportinggrille 14 inFIG. 3 . The supportinggrille 14 is a plate-like body, where the width of the supportinggrille 14 is the maximum thickness of the plate-like body. - The
plastic member 10 mainly plays the role of structural support for the whole water pan, and the foamingmember 20 mainly plays the role of heat preservation for the whole water pan. If the foamingmember 20 is provided with the supporting grille, because of the nature of the material itself, it is difficult to control the width of the supporting grille between 1.5 mm and 3.2 mm, and in the related art, in the solution of the foamingmember 20 provided with the supporting grille, the width of the provided supporting grille is usually about 10 mm, thus the wind resistance to theair outlet 12 is larger. - In some embodiments, the foaming
member 20 and theplastic member 10 are integrally formed, and the integral forming of theplastic member 10 and the foamingmember 20 may eliminate the assembly error and improve the fit clearance between an air guiding ring and a fan wheel of the air conditioner. The integral forming here means that the two are casted together during injection molding, so that the assembly step may be saved, the fit accuracy of the foamingmember 20 and theplastic member 10 is good, and the individual difference of the water pan is small. - In some embodiments, the process method of the integral forming of the foaming
member 20 and theplastic member 10 includes injection molding theplastic member 10, and directly casting a foam material on theplastic member 10 with a mold after the formedplastic member 10 is solidified, so that the foam material and theplastic member 10 are at least partially melted together, and the foam material is connected with theplastic member 10 after the foam material is solidified. - The structural strength of the
plastic member 10 is greater than that of the foamingmember 20. Therefore, theplastic member 10 is first injected molded, and the foam material is injected after theplastic member 10 is solidified to form the foamingmember 20 on theplastic member 10. Theplastic member 10 and the foamingmember 20 are at least partially melted together, so that theplastic member 10 and the foamingmember 20 form an integrally formed structure. Therefore, theplastic member 10 and the foamingmember 20 are inseparable two parts, and they do not have to be installed separately during the production of the air conditioner, thus the relative position of theplastic member 10 and the foamingmember 20 is very accurate, and no assembly errors will be generated. - When the foam material is casted, the surface of the
plastic member 10 in contact with it may be partially melted, to fuse with the foam material into a whole. The part of theplastic member 10 in contact with the foamingmember 20 may also not melt with each other. - In some embodiments, the width of the supporting
grille 14 ranges from 2 mm to 3 mm, for example from 2 mm to 2.5 mm. The size of the supportinggrille 14 not only has sufficient structural strength, but also causes very small wind resistance to theair outlet 12, which realizes a larger air outlet area and improves air outlet efficiency. - The
